| Application: | EPA 524.2 Rev 4 Update Mix may be used as an analytical standard to quantify volatile organic compound (VOC) analytes in indoor, outdoor, and occupational environments by gas chromatography coupled to mass spectrometry (GC-MS). |
| Application: | Refer to the product′s Certificate of Analysis for more information on a suitable instrument technique. Contact Technical Service for further support. |
| General description: | EPA 524.2 Rev 4 Update Mix may be utilized for identifying and quantifying volatile organic compounds (VOCs) in drinking water. The pre-requisite of EPA 524.2 method is the use of gas chromatography with a selective detector, gas chromatography/mass spectrometry or high performance liquid chromatography. |
